What’s Really Going On At The Postal Service

President Trump on Thursday suggested he was holding up a deal on coronavirus relief in part to ensure the U.S. Postal Service would not have sufficient funds to handle mass mail-in ballots this fall, falsely conflating various pressures the agency is facing.

While congressional Democrats are seeking to provide $25 billion to USPS to help the cash-strapped agency, postal management has never indicated it requires that funding to deliver absentee and other mailed ballots for the forthcoming election. To the contrary, USPS has repeatedly made clear it can easily absorb any uptick in mailed ballots and has long been preparing for such an event.
